我们使用Charles代理将请求从一个系统重定向到另一个系统。例如,如果我需要从A向D发送请求,我会通过设置了查尔斯代理的B发送请求。
现在可以将所有到达B中的Charles代理的请求转发到在C中设置的另一个Charles代理。
A (只知道B)-> B (Charles proxy,需要自动转发到C) -> C (Charles Proxy)-> D (最终目的地)
你能告诉我怎样才能做到这一点吗?
我正在通过代理连接移动设备和系统,并捕获在移动设备中进行的调用。
当"https“请求被捕获时,我无法从它获得响应。系统中出现以下错误:-
No request was made. Possibly the SSL certificate was rejected.
Client Process: java
You may need to configure your browser or application to trust the Charles Root Certificate. See SSL Proxying in the Help menu.
注意:我已经在系统上安装了
我试图通过chrome扩展来处理代理身份验证。
一方面,我有铬扩展(建立了所有权限),它向onAuthRequired处理程序 (background.js)发送连接请求。
chrome.webRequest.onAuthRequired.addListener(
(details, callback) => {
console.log('onAuthRequired', details) // <- this has never been displayed
callback({
authCreden
我通常使用Charles Proxy来捕获浏览器中的请求/响应。但是现在我在手机上开发Air应用程序。即使我在我的PC上运行它,Charles也没有捕捉到Air的请求。
1) Can I configure Charles Proxy to catch requests/responses outside of browser?
如果不是:
2) What tool do you use to sniff requests/responses outside of browser?
我的电脑既有Windows 8,也有Mac OS。
我正在尝试将一个ClickListener注册到Button。我使用的是Vaadin 8,这个侦听器应该使用代理来实现。
final Button button = new Button("Hello");
final Class<?> clickListenerClass = Button.ClickListener.class;
final Object clickListenerInstance = Proxy.newProxyInstance(clickListenerClass.getClassLoader(),
new Class[] {cli
我正在开发一个应用程序,它使用Unity.WWW来制作超文本传输协议web请求。当我们使用这个类时,我可以通过Charles Web Proxy看到所有的请求。我们,刚刚升级到使用UnityWebRequest,现在我们在Charles中看不到任何使用这个类的调用,即使我们可以看到使用WireShark的调用。
有没有办法配置Charles来捕获这些,或者这是Unity的bug,或者可能是Charles的bug?